Output 21ec76c74f494e3b7c588de4fa212ca528722b6b7e5227f60e6be3599c15a077:0

value
2841000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f57273d68688ace20a90d366976c211ffb31280 OP_EQUAL
address
37Tvu9NdaMPXQvrnHtVku1DhJpSejfcaGc
transaction
21ec76c74f494e3b7c588de4fa212ca528722b6b7e5227f60e6be3599c15a077
spent
true